GoCD - Angular Build не может выполнить - PullRequest
0 голосов
/ 23 мая 2019

Я работаю над интерфейсом GoCD для конфигурации развертывания Angular.Я настроил npm install, но после того, как я пытаюсь выполнить команду сборки, как показано ниже, но она выдает ошибку вроде

Пожалуйста, убедитесь, что [/ usr / local / lib / node_modules / @ angular / cli / bin/ ng build] может быть выполнена на этом агенте.

/usr/local/bin/ng build --configuration=qa

Пожалуйста, проверьте ниже вывод консоли.(Это работает, если я выполню вышеупомянутое в моей машине непосредственно)

Примечание: я настроил GoCD в моем локальном Mac.

Любая помощь будет оценена.

 [go] Task: "/usr/local/lib/node_modules/@angular/cli/bin/ng build" --configuration=qatook: 0.5s
    Error happened while attempting to execute '/usr/local/lib/node_modules/@angular/cli/bin/ng build --configuration=qa'. 
    Please make sure [/usr/local/lib/node_modules/@angular/cli/bin/ng build] can be executed on this agent.

  [Debug Information] Environment variable PATH: /usr/local/mysql/bin:/usr/local/sbin:/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in
    [go] Task status: failed, took: 0.5s
    [go] Current job status: failed

1 Ответ

0 голосов
/ 28 мая 2019

Это глупая ошибка, которую я совершил. GoCD упомянул это ниже в поле ввода.

В основном, если это несколько аргументов, то нам нужно поместить это в новую строку. Так что после этого все заработало нормально.

так что в моем случае это было бы как,

build
--configuration=qa

Пожалуйста, смотрите скриншот.

enter image description here

...